What is GPT-3?

Before diving into the applications, let’s quickly summarize what GPT-3 is. Launched in June 2020 by OpenAI, GPT-3 (Generative Pre-trained Transformer 3) takes natural language processing to the next level. With 175 billion parameters, it outperforms its predecessors and can generate human-like text based on minimal prompts. This versatility allows it to be used in various applications such as content creation, customer support, coding, and much more.
